Well, first off, they do not match scholarships from other schools, it seems that they don't really "negotiate" either. They will reconsider you and will get a response before their deposit deadline.beef wellington wrote:Any general tips you think might benefit the thread at large, as far as how you approached the negotiation?Veritas wrote:No problem deemdeem wrote:
Thanks for the quick and helpful response, Veritas. I'll have to look into what exactly to say when I write them. Would you mind if I pm for some advice? thanks again.
Just let them know you are interested in them and what they have to offer and that you would like to please be reconsidered for a higher scholarship.
